Jealous was surprised. He hadn’t even sensed her approach until she grabbed him.
It wasn’t like the training grounds were noisy. He must have become insensitive to the surrounding sounds because he was engrossed in the sparring.
After the surprise subsided, he became angry at the force gripping his forearm.
What was absurd was that Kata also looked equally angry.
“What are you doing? Let go of my arm.”
Kata slowly released her grip. However, she didn’t withdraw her hostile gaze.
At her unexpected animosity, Jealous felt a surge of anger.
“Why are you interfering? Who do you think you are?”
“Anyone has the right to stop violence.”
“Huh? The coward who was pathetic from day one is all talk. Don’t you know how helpful sparring with a stronger opponent is in actual combat?”
“Stronger? You?”
At her expression of genuine bewilderment, Jealous felt a flash of white-hot anger.
His hand moved before he could even register it.
*Crack!*
Fragments of the wooden sword scattered. Jealous’ pupils slowly dilated.
The wooden sword was cleanly broken. It was because of the Aura that had appeared, tearing through the air.
Only Second Awakened could draw pure Aura from the air without a medium.
“…….”
He turned his head and saw Xenon Corer with a subtle expression.
He was someone you didn’t want to make an enemy of. Rumor had it that a full knight had already marked him as a prospective squire.
Xenon’s face hardened, as if slightly bewildered. The pure Aura that had extended from his hand faded, then disappeared as if nothing had happened.
He looked back and forth between Kata and Jealous, then reluctantly dragged his feet as he approached.
“Don’t cause a disturbance here. Unless you want to be disciplined.”
His tone was flat.
Jealous glared at Xenon, but couldn’t express any further hostility. Just seeing the Aura he had momentarily released sent chills down his spine.
‘Monster bastard.’
Jealous turned his head sharply and glared at Peter.
“Peter, you tell me. Wasn’t what we were doing just now a legitimate spar? Did I give you some kind of handicap?”
“N-, no.”
“Then why are you keeping your mouth shut? Do you want to avoid fighting me that much? Just like a damn coward…”
At that moment, Kata stepped forward as if to protect Peter.
“Jellis.”
“It’s Jealous.”
“…Jealous.”
After correcting his name, Kata continued forcefully, “I’m sorry, but you’re not strong enough to be intimidated by. If this person is scared, there must be another reason.”
Sparks flew from Jealous’s eyes. He looked down at Kata, who had lifted her chin, then said in a low voice, “You talk too much, coward.”
His lips curled into a cruel smile.
“That day, they say you fainted at the mere sight of a monster. While your mother was bravely fighting and dying, you were lying there comfortably-“
“Jealous.”
Xenon placed a warning hand on Jealous’s shoulder. His gaze was icy cold.
Catarina Donovan’s expression behind him was even more interesting.
Jealous shook off Xenon’s hand and sneered at her.
“Do you still feel the urge to pee when you see a monster? Rumor has it you were so scared you even wet yourself. It’s a pity for those who died trying to protect a coward like you-“
*Wham!*
Jealous was knocked off his feet in a single blow and sprawled on the ground with a heavy thud. Something warm trickled from his nose.
“…….”
He blinked blankly.
It would have been less shocking if Xenon had hit him.
But it was definitely Kata’s solid fist that had struck his face. A force that disregarded their clear difference in physique.
“Young M- Jealous!”
Peter’s voice sounded distant.
Was I careless?
No.
He had anticipated the punch after seeing her face contorted with anger. But it wasn’t a speed his body could react to.
He placed his hand on the ground with difficulty.
“You… damn…”
As he wiped his nose and saw the blood, anger surged like a tidal wave. He sprang to his feet and reached for Kata.
“Don’t, Jealous. Let’s go to the infirmary first.”
Peter grabbed his arm urgently from behind, but he cursed and shook him off forcefully. His fingertips tingled with a near-murderous urge.
That’s when it happened. Xenon’s icy face blocked his path.
“You heard him. Go to the infirmary first.”
“…Get out of my way.”
“If you leave it untreated for too long, the healing will take much longer. Go, quickly.”
“…….”
“Aren’t you going?”
Their eyes met. Xenon didn’t bother to hide the contempt on his face.
Damn him. Acting all high and mighty just because he’s good with a sword…
“Just you wait, Donovan.”
Jealous turned sharply. His clenched fist trembled with boiling murderous intent, but he couldn’t bring himself to look back.
***
Kata clenched and unclenched her fist. Maybe she shouldn’t have hit him.
“That day, they say you fainted at the mere sight of a monster.”
It wasn’t wrong. That’s why it hurt more.
The Divine-Demonic War two centuries ago ended in humanity’s victory. Thanks to the sacrifice of the legendary knight, Sir Weber.
The Demon King and his three apostles were sealed, and the Donovan family, who had been loyal vassals of the Emperor for generations, were entrusted with one of the seals.
However, in the winter of Imperial Year 874, the seal in Count Donovan’s territory was broken for the first time. Later, a second apostle was released in the south.
Now only two seals remained.
The shadow of war loomed over the Empire once again.
“What have you protected with your sword all this time?”
Kata squeezed her eyes shut and opened them again. The protruding knuckles of her fist ached.
“Um, you didn’t have to do that… Thank you.”
She looked up at the cautious voice and saw Peter looking at her anxiously.
“I’m Peter. I already know your name, Catarina.”
“Oh, yeah. Call me Kata. Are you alright?”
“I’m fine. I’m pretty good at taking hits.”
Peter laughed, rubbing his side.
Xenon suddenly interjected, “Why didn’t you fight back?”
“Huh?”
“I know Jealous’s skills roughly. He hasn’t even properly mastered the basics of swordsmanship, he just got lucky with his First Awakening. That brat still hasn’t broken his habit of picking fights, relying on his status…”
His assessment was quite harsh. Xenon abruptly stopped talking, his face strained as if holding back, then opened his mouth again.
“I don’t know your exact skills, but at least he’s not so strong that you wouldn’t have a chance to counterattack. You know that better than anyone, don’t you?”
Peter’s eyes widened. He hesitated for a moment before answering.
“Well, I’ve worked as Jealous’s attendant for a long time. I’ve been his sparring partner since we were young.”
Xenon’s expression suggested he understood.
“So, not fighting back… it’s an old habit. And I don’t know how this will sound, but I’m okay. I can endure it.”
“Is enduring it also a habit?”
Despite the indifferent remark, Peter simply smiled pleasantly and didn’t answer.
Xenon turned his head.
His gaze slid down from Kata’s face and lingered on the hand that had struck Jealous.
Kata immediately understood the implication of his gaze. A slow smile spread across her round face.
“I’m fine, Xenon.”
“…….”
If he were eleven-year-old Xenon, he would have snapped back, saying he wouldn’t have even asked in the first place.
But Xenon and Kata were now past adulthood, and their once close relationship had widened beyond repair.
“…The time when you could do whatever you wanted is over.”
“I know.”
The conversation went astray. The afternoon sunlight melted into the sharp lines of his face.
Xenon stared at the woman who didn’t seem discouraged at all by his cold words, then turned away.
Seeing her unchanging smile even after hearing his sharp insults made him feel uncomfortable.
